Dream About Familiar Environments: Unraveling Your Subconscious
Recurring dreams of finding yourself in a strangely familiar setting are not uncommon. These dreams can occur even in places you’ve never actually visited in your waking life. They suggest that your subconscious is at work, revisiting spaces and experiences that have left a significant mark on your mind.
Understanding the Dream
Dreams that feature these recognizable environments often represent the metamorphosis of childhood memories etched deep within your subconscious. They can be reflections of both joyful moments and past sorrows, fluctuating based on the emotions you experience during the dream.
When you find peace and happiness in such a dream, it may indicate your brain's attempt to recreate a positive experience, allowing for relaxation and emotional relief. Conversely, if the memory is tied to stress or sadness, the dream serves as a means to release lingering anxiety related to past events. Regardless of the nature of the memory, this process forms a critical part of your body’s self-regulation mechanism.
The Role of Stimuli
When you fall asleep, your ability to react to regular stimuli in your environment diminishes significantly. However, subtle external triggers that may go unnoticed during the day can become prominent signals in your dreams. These signals can amplify certain active areas in your brain, leading to the recollection and modification of buried memories from your past.
This phenomenon often results when minor environmental factors combine to evoke memories that you may not consciously recall. Your subconscious mind processes these cues and can resurrect memories in transformed, abstract forms. Thus, when you experience dreams in support of these familiar surroundings, they often evoke feelings of nostalgia and déjà vu.
The Familiarity Paradox
While the environment, people, and events encountered in such dreams may evoke a sense of familiarity, they may also leave you puzzled about their true origins. You might feel a strong connection to these dream settings despite having never physically experienced them. This paradox indicates that your mind is diving into deep-seated memories creatively, crafting them into dream narratives that resonate with you emotionally.
What appears in your dreams—those faces, places, and events—may not be direct replicas but rather remixes of various moments from your life, filtered through the lens of your emotional state. The emotions you carry while dreaming play a vital role in determining whether these recollections are tied to uplifting experiences or past anxieties.
